RESOLUTION NO.51
BE IT RESOLVED toy the Council
of the City of Moses Lake,Wash
ington,as follows:
Section 1.
That Is the intention of the Council
of the City of Moses Lake,Wash
ington,to order the Improvement of
the following described streets within
the city by the construction and
Installation of sidewalks and com
bined curblngs and gutters as here
inafter described and by doing such
other work as may be necessary In
connection therewith,all In accord
ance with plans prepared by the
city's engineers.
(A).The following streets shall be
Improved by the construction of a
concrete combined curb and gutter
which will have a 2'6"over-all width
and a 2'apron on the front of the
curb:

All of said sidewalks shall be 4
Inches thick with the exception of
driveways,which will be 5 Inches
thick In the driveway sections; pro
vided that no sidewalks shall be con
structed as above provided where
they are already in existence.
Section 2.
All persons who may desire to
object thereto are hereby notified
to appear and present sucn objec
tions at a meeting of the City Coun
cil to be held In the High School
Gymnasium in the City of Moses
Lake,Washington,at 8:00 o'clock
p.m.on the 23rd day of June.1949.
which time and place Is hereby fixed
for hearing all matters relating to
said proposed improvement and all
objections thereto,and for determin
ing the method of payment for said
Improvement.
Section 3.
G. D. Hall & Associates,consult
ing engineers,Yakima,Washington,
employed by the city in the matter
of this Improvement, are hereby di
rected to submit to the Council at
or prior to the date fixed for special
hearing the estimated cost and ex
pense of such Improvement,a state
ment of the proportionate amount
thereof which should be borne by
the property within the proposed as
sessment district,a statement of the
aggregate assessed and actual valua
tions of all the real estate,exclu
sive of improvements,within said
district according to the valuation
last placed upon It for the purpose
of general taxation,together with
a diagram or print showing thereon
the lots,tracts and parcels of land
and other property which will be
specially benefitted thereby and the
estimated amount of the cost and
expense of such improvement to be
borne by each such lot,tract or par
cel of land or other property.
Section 4.
The entire cost and expense of said
Improvement shall be borne by and
assessed against the property liable
therefore as provided by law.
Section 5.
The City Clerk Is hereby directed
to give notice of said hearing by
publication of this resolution in the
manner required by law and by mail
ing a notice of such hearing as re
quired by law to each owner or re
puted owner of any lot,tract or
parcel of land or other property
specially benefitted by the Improve
ment,and to specify in said mailed
notices the nature of the proposed
Improvement,the total estimated
cost thereof,and the estimated bene
fit to the particular lot,traot or
parcel of land owned by such person.
PASSED by the Council or the City
of Moses Lake,Washington,and ap
proved by its Mayor this 24th day
of May,1949.
CITY OF MOSES LAKE,
WASHINGTON
By C. M.McCOSH,Mayor.
